Bio-Butanol Market Market Structure & Innovation Trends

The Bio-Butanol market exhibits a moderately concentrated structure, with a blend of established chemical companies and emerging biotechnology firms vying for market share. Innovation is a key differentiator, driven by advancements in fermentation technologies, feedstock optimization, and the development of novel downstream applications. Regulatory frameworks, including government mandates for biofuels and stringent environmental regulations, play a pivotal role in shaping market entry and growth. Product substitutes, primarily petroleum-based butanol, face increasing pressure from the sustainability imperative and fluctuating oil prices. End-user demographics are shifting towards industries actively seeking green alternatives, such as automotive, paints & coatings, and consumer goods. Mergers and acquisitions (M&A) are becoming more prevalent as companies seek to consolidate intellectual property and expand their market reach. For instance, the acquisition of the Butamax patent estate by Gevo Inc. in September 2021 highlights this trend, bolstering its intellectual property portfolio for renewable isobutanol and derivative products, valued at an estimated $75 million. Market share within specific segments is still evolving, with biofuel applications currently holding the largest share, estimated at 35% in 2025.

Dominant Regions & Segments in Bio-Butanol Market

The global Bio-Butanol market is characterized by distinct regional strengths and segment dominance, driven by a combination of economic policies, technological adoption, and resource availability.

North America currently leads the bio-butanol market, with the United States being a primary contributor. This dominance is attributed to:

  • Robust Biofuel Mandates: The Renewable Fuel Standard (RFS) in the U.S. has been a significant catalyst, promoting the use of biofuels, including those derived from bio-butanol.
  • Advanced Agricultural Infrastructure: The region boasts a well-established agricultural sector, providing ample feedstock availability for bio-butanol production.
  • Technological Innovation: Significant investments in research and development by leading companies have fostered innovation in production technologies and applications.
  • Government Support: Favorable policies and subsidies for renewable energy and bio-based products further bolster market growth.

Asia Pacific is emerging as a rapidly growing region, driven by increasing environmental awareness, government initiatives to reduce carbon emissions, and a burgeoning industrial base. Key economies like China and India are witnessing substantial growth in the demand for bio-butanol across various applications.

The Biofuel segment holds the largest market share within the bio-butanol market, projected to be around 35% in 2025. This dominance is fueled by:

  • Energy Security and Sustainability Goals: Governments worldwide are prioritizing the reduction of reliance on fossil fuels and promoting cleaner energy sources.
  • Cost-Effectiveness and Performance: Bio-butanol offers comparable or superior performance to conventional gasoline and diesel in certain applications, coupled with a significantly lower carbon footprint.
  • Existing Infrastructure Compatibility: Bio-butanol can be blended with existing gasoline and diesel fuels with minimal or no modifications to current infrastructure.

Beyond biofuels, other significant application segments are showing strong growth trajectories:

  • Acrylates: Used in the production of paints, coatings, adhesives, and textiles, this segment is driven by the demand for low-VOC (Volatile Organic Compound) products.
  • Acetates: Primarily used as solvents in inks, coatings, and cleaning agents, the demand is fueled by the need for environmentally friendly solvent alternatives.
  • Glycol Ethers: Employed in a wide range of applications including paints, coatings, and industrial cleaners, bio-based glycol ethers offer a sustainable option.
  • Plasticizers: Used to impart flexibility to plastics, bio-butanol-derived plasticizers are gaining traction due to health and environmental concerns associated with traditional phthalate-based plasticizers.

Challenges in the Bio-Butanol Market Sector

Despite its promising growth, the bio-butanol market faces several challenges. High production costs compared to conventional petrochemical butanol, particularly in regions with less established infrastructure, can be a barrier to widespread adoption. Ensuring a consistent and cost-effective supply of sustainable feedstock remains a concern, with potential competition for land and resources. The scalability of current bio-production technologies to meet large-scale industrial demand also presents a challenge. Furthermore, navigating complex and varying international regulatory landscapes for bio-based products can hinder market expansion. The initial capital investment required for establishing bio-butanol production facilities can be substantial, impacting the pace of market penetration.
